At its core, blockchain is a distributed, immutable ledger – a shared, transparent record of transactions that is cryptographically secured and duplicated across numerous computers. This inherent transparency and tamper-proof nature dismantle the need for traditional intermediaries, the gatekeepers who have historically controlled financial flows. Think about the traditional banking system: a labyrinth of trusted third parties, each adding layers of complexity, cost, and potential points of failure. Blockchain offers a compelling alternative, a peer-to-peer network where transactions can occur directly between parties, fostering efficiency and reducing friction.

Beyond individual cryptocurrencies, the concept of Decentralized Finance, or DeFi, is emerging as a powerful force. DeFi aims to recreate traditional financial services – lending, borrowing, trading, insurance – on decentralized blockchain networks. Instead of interacting with a bank for a loan, you might interact with a smart contract, a self-executing program stored on the blockchain that automatically enforces the terms of an agreement. This disintermediation can lead to more competitive interest rates for both lenders and borrowers, increased accessibility for those excluded from traditional finance, and greater transparency in financial operations. Platforms like Aave and Compound have demonstrated the viability of decentralized lending and borrowing, allowing users to earn interest on their crypto assets or borrow against them without going through a traditional credit check.

One of the most significant advancements is the maturation of Decentralized Finance (DeFi). This burgeoning ecosystem aims to build an open, borderless, and transparent financial system that is accessible to anyone with an internet connection. Unlike traditional finance, where services are often siloed and controlled by a few powerful entities, DeFi operates on public blockchains, primarily Ethereum, allowing for programmable money and permissionless innovation. Smart contracts are the engines driving DeFi, automating complex financial transactions without the need for intermediaries. These self-executing contracts, coded onto the blockchain, can manage everything from issuing loans and facilitating trades to distributing insurance payouts. This programmability unlocks a level of customization and efficiency that traditional finance struggles to match.
Consider the concept of stablecoins, a crucial component of the DeFi landscape. These cryptocurrencies are pegged to the value of a stable asset, such as the US dollar or gold, thereby mitigating the extreme volatility often associated with other cryptocurrencies. Stablecoins act as a bridge between the traditional fiat economy and the burgeoning crypto world, providing a reliable medium of exchange and a store of value within decentralized applications. They are essential for trading, lending, and borrowing in DeFi, offering a degree of predictability that encourages wider adoption and participation. Projects like USDT, USDC, and DAI have become foundational elements, enabling users to navigate the crypto markets with greater confidence.
The opportunities in decentralized lending and borrowing are particularly compelling. Through DeFi protocols, individuals can lend their digital assets to earn interest, often at rates significantly higher than those offered by traditional banks. Conversely, users can borrow assets by providing collateral, bypassing the often-onerous credit checks and lengthy approval processes of conventional lending institutions. This democratization of credit has the potential to empower individuals and small businesses who may have been excluded from traditional financial services due to lack of credit history or collateral. The transparency of these protocols also means that users can scrutinize the underlying smart contracts and collateralization ratios, fostering a sense of trust built on verifiable code rather than opaque institutional practices.
Moreover, the world of decentralized exchanges (DEXs) offers a new way to trade digital assets. Unlike centralized exchanges that hold user funds and match buyers and sellers, DEXs allow users to trade directly from their own wallets through peer-to-peer smart contracts. This eliminates counterparty risk – the risk that the exchange itself might fail or be compromised – and gives users full control over their private keys and assets. While DEXs can sometimes present liquidity challenges or a steeper learning curve for new users, their inherent security and censorship resistance make them an attractive alternative for many in the blockchain space.

For those with a knack for understanding complex systems and identifying potential pitfalls, Smart Contract Auditing and Verification stands out. Smart contracts are the automated agreements that power much of the decentralized web, executing transactions and enforcing rules without intermediaries. However, a single bug or vulnerability in a smart contract can lead to the loss of millions of dollars, as seen in numerous high-profile incidents. Therefore, the demand for meticulous auditors who can scrutinize code for security flaws, logical errors, and adherence to best practices is immense. These professionals are essentially the guardians of the decentralized economy, and their expertise is compensated accordingly, with top-tier auditors commanding very high rates, often on a per-project basis or through lucrative retainer agreements. The ability to think like an attacker, coupled with a deep understanding of the specific programming languages used for smart contracts (like Solidity), is the golden ticket here.
Beyond development and security, the business and strategic side of blockchain is also booming. Tokenomics Design is a burgeoning field that focuses on the economic principles behind cryptocurrencies and blockchain-based applications. Tokenomics experts are responsible for designing the supply, distribution, and utility of tokens within a specific ecosystem. They consider factors like inflation, deflation, staking rewards, governance mechanisms, and incentives to ensure the long-term sustainability and value of a digital asset. A well-designed tokenomic model can attract investors, engage users, and foster a thriving community, making these strategists invaluable. As more projects launch their own tokens, the demand for skilled tokenomics designers who can create sound economic models continues to grow, offering substantial consulting fees or high-level positions.
